The “E” in e-government can be defined narrowly as ‘electronic,’ or the movement of government information, service, and transaction delivery to the Internet.  More broadly, the “E” represents an opportunity for the government to innovate its delivery of information, services, and transactions in entirely new ways, making the future effectively, Entrepreneurial Government “EnGov”.
 
This event is for Government and Private Sector Information Technology professionals.  The organizers of this inaugural EnGov Forum have chosen the area of wireless communications as its topic, because, the anticipated changes in wireless technology promise a more innovative and efficient EnGov, but these opportunities also raise a series of difficult questions.  Presented will be current and future technology, security issues, business parameters, national direction, plus robust discussions from various views intended to benefit all attendees.
